TEFL certification refers to a qualification specifically for teaching English – abroad or online – to English language learners. Important Information *SMS & TEXT MESSAGINGAnswer: Nevada offers certification to substitute teachers with a minimum of 60 college credits required. It also offers an emergency substitute certificate for school districts that qualify and present a written request, which requires a minimum of a high school diploma or GED. References: 1.

Massachusetts Teacher Outlook, Salary, and Jobs. There were about 1,856 K-12 public schools in Massachusetts during the 2016-2017 school year, with an estimated student enrollment of 964,514. 3 With approximately 72,413 public school teachers, this gave Massachusetts an overall student-to-teacher ratio of 13:1. 3.

Credentialing Information. How to Become a Teacher in California. I want to teach in elementary school. Individuals who want to teach in elementary school in California must earn a Multiple Subject Teaching Credential. In order to earn Special Education teacher certification with American Board, you will need to meet the following requirements: Hold a Bachelor’s degree or higher. Submit your official college or university transcripts to the American Board. Pass a national background check. Pass the Professional Teaching Knowledge exam (PTK).

A teacher certification or teaching certification is a professional credential that verifies the holder has the necessary skills and other qualifications to be able to teach students in a classroom. For most teaching certificates, you'll need at least a bachelor’s degree. If you don’t already have a bachelor’s, you can often earn your degree and your teaching certificate at the same time!
